ESTConnector location?

I have tried to set the timeing on my 87 4bbl ccc lg4 without any luck. (Totally stock with the smaller distributor, comp controlled).I have looked in a 2 thirdgen manuals (1 camaro/1 firebird) and both say that the est connector is a 1 wire connector with a tan wire/black tracer in and out. I know exactly what it looks like since I had an 87 350 tbi blazer had with this same deal. Anyway, I have been looking for over two hours for the son if a bitch and am totally dumfounded where it is. I have looked in all the wire harnesses up by the ac condenser to behind the block then over to the driver side and no luck. Actually I did at least find a tan wire with black tracer but it comes out of the biggest harness and goes behind the block and down to the trans and plugs in on top of it. Any help would be greatly appreciated. Thanks in advance, Bret

Re: ESTConnector location?

normally on every thirdgen ive seen it will sit up by the passenger side strut its just got a 1 wire connection so the plug i s fairly small

hope that helps a bit
